Maxim Leshchenko
6588734caa
Support: Allow agents to prevent users from creating tickets
2022-03-26 22:06:07 +01:00
celestora
881665831e
Allow non-cased letters in names
2022-02-08 12:15:29 +02:00
veselcraft
47093f40cc
Users: Bring back ability to NOT set the last names
2022-02-07 20:16:47 +03:00
Ilya Prokopenko
e5afb0fc88
Users, Groups: Fix URL avatar output
...
This commit fixes the avatar URL output for those who visit the website with a port (e.g. ovk.domain.tld:1337)
2022-02-06 16:10:35 +03:00
Celestora
51ace8d888
Enforce usage of non-empty, correct profile names.
...
Resolves #456
2022-02-05 20:09:37 +02:00
veselcraft
1df0545061
[WIP Maybe] Email: Add verification mechanism
...
This does work only if email is required by instance. If you're sysadmin, you can configure it in openvk.yml.
2022-01-31 14:45:53 +03:00
Maxim Leshchenko
3edf34e0ea
Global: Add user option to hide ad poster
2022-01-03 21:13:53 +02:00
Maxim Leshchenko
e5c650e351
Messenger: Allow sending messages not only to friends and add a privacy setting to customize this
...
Closes #91
2021-12-28 11:40:14 +02:00
Maxim Leshchenko
0a6ce0ffc0
Users: Do not delete subscriptions when banned for flood requests
...
It wasn't cool
2021-12-25 22:32:15 +02:00
veselcraft
efa89e075f
Global: Define standard unix time values
...
Thanks @vladislav805 for the idea!
2021-12-25 14:21:39 +03:00
Maxim Leshchenko
948719ec3d
Groups: Do not show group pin button in group list when the group cannot be pinned
2021-12-24 22:08:03 +02:00
Maxim Leshchenko
8edebcb0d5
Users: Add ability to hide custom links by users through settings
2021-12-17 18:58:31 +02:00
veselcraft
6ef1e533da
Users: Birthday refactoring
...
Also fixes #118
2021-12-14 18:53:44 +03:00
Maxim Leshchenko
24624bb147
Users: Show all groups in the list of managed groups
2021-12-03 20:08:50 +02:00
Maxim Leshchenko
e433e83c5d
Users: Add two-factor authentication ( #321 )
...
This commit adds full TOTP 2FA. And even backup codes modeled on the original VK
2021-12-02 17:31:32 +02:00
veselcraft
fd2ef5fad5
User: Age refactoring
...
Лапский, это вообще пиздец какой-то. Проще не додумался сделать?
2021-11-27 21:02:37 +03:00
veselcraft
b2a993d649
Groups: Hotfix for "Managers" tab
2021-11-20 13:53:54 +03:00
veselcraft
e5238ecc41
User: Added a tab in "My Groups" page for usual and managed groups
2021-11-20 13:47:59 +03:00
veselcraft
9cef1f630f
Users: Added a getWebsite function just to fix unworking state xddd
2021-11-13 15:13:44 +03:00
Maxim Leshchenko
e3358fcfa5
Pinning groups to the left menu
...
This commit allows you to pin groups to the left menu (max 10 groups, only those in which you are the administrator) from the My Groups page. Fixes #186
2021-11-10 11:18:25 +02:00
Celestora
c0c35c3872
Fix #161 : online status bug
2021-11-04 13:45:30 +02:00
Celestora
e5ea1cd351
Make kromer storage type "real" to allow buying cents/pennies
2021-11-03 19:19:15 +02:00
Celestora
9e86389b62
Add admin-placeable alerts
2021-11-02 23:07:26 +02:00
Celestora
b39dd44143
Settings: Add configurable shortcode length constraint
2021-10-13 23:41:12 +03:00
Celestora
ec4757f356
Commerce: allow disabling commerce in configuration
...
Resolves #183
2021-10-12 12:20:08 +03:00
Vladimir Barinov
81e5f2ae2c
Profile: Refactor rating bar. Again.
...
@celestora is not going to follow my idea kek
2021-10-10 00:05:20 +03:00
Celestora
b25af9b14d
Refactor function name
2021-10-09 22:44:48 +03:00
Celestora
5c9c09c7a9
Refactor rating bar
2021-10-09 22:42:20 +03:00
Celestora
9336a91623
Add gifts
...
Signed-off-by: Celestora <kitsuruko@gmail.com>
2021-10-07 11:48:55 +03:00
Celestora
255d70e974
Add vouchers
...
Signed-off-by: Celestora <kitsuruko@gmail.com>
2021-10-07 11:47:30 +03:00
0x7d5
d996be443f
User: one more fix with birthday
2021-09-14 12:12:41 +05:00
0x7d5
bda20336b8
User: Fixed crashwhen going to the page of a user who has no birthday
2021-09-13 23:35:10 +05:00
0x7d5
bbf113bfd5
Profile: Added birthday
2021-09-13 21:34:02 +05:00
Ilya Prokopenko
dd307f29c2
Invite: normal implementation
...
Co-authored-by: celestora <kitsuruko@gmail.com>
2021-09-13 10:22:05 +07:00
root
7f1a5f2354
User: Now the User's page can be marked as Deceased. And now the user can be Incognito (at least, admins)
...
To mark the page as Deceased, type in field in Database. To be Incognito, type in field.
Specially for deceased drbream
2021-09-11 01:33:45 +03:00
Celestina Rempai
574f4918e5
Fix avatar erros
2021-02-06 20:38:39 +00:00
Alma Armas
fc9df5624b
Add NSFW CW back
...
Co-authored-by: Celestine <34442450+rem-pai@users.noreply.github.com>
2021-01-07 16:19:36 +00:00
Alma Armas
5f8c4ed248
Merge branch 'master' of https://github.com/openvk/openvk
2021-01-04 17:38:35 +00:00
Alma Armas
8b1bc4b894
[FIX] HTTPS errors in Tracy
2021-01-04 17:38:17 +00:00
veselcraft
057e6c5c63
[NEW FEATURE] Microblog
...
Can be enabled in settings
2021-01-04 12:33:25 -05:00
Alma Armas
a608ebc1a7
Always return absolute URLs for avatars
2020-09-29 13:03:55 -07:00
Alma Armas
af6eeb882c
Add quickban button for admins
2020-07-17 16:26:59 +00:00
Jill Stingray
48a2040322
Fix fatal error when changing username
...
I forgot name of DatabaseConnection class xddd
2020-06-23 20:05:13 +00:00
fkwa
0f89de3011
Fix address collision
2020-06-20 10:57:21 +02:00
Jill Stingray
d509096d46
Add themepack support
2020-06-11 23:21:49 +03:00
Jill Stingray
db845c3c0b
Initial commit
2020-06-07 19:04:43 +03:00